Abstract

This chapter explores the pivotal role of rare earth ions in quantum nanophotonics. Drawing from comprehensive texts, it covers growth techniques, material topologies, and the unique electronic configurations of rare earth-doped materials. The narrative emphasizes their indispensable role in quantum optics, including applications in computing, sensing, and secure communication. The chapter highlights applications of rare earth ions in quantum devices like lasers, imaging tools, and low-dimensional materials for quantum technologies. Discussions extend to insulators, spectral hole burning, and their relevance in optical filters and laser line narrowing. The synthesis widens its focus to ultrasonic-optical tissue imaging, detailing applications in cancer imaging, cardiovascular studies, and drug delivery monitoring. It concludes with a discussion of solid-state optical devices, emphasizing their transformative impact on medicine, material processing, displays, and sensing.
